#' @title sumStrStage: calculate structural stage for each plot
#'
#' @description This function calculates structural stage metric from Ecological Integrity Scorecard,
#' which assigns Pole, Mature, Late Successional, or Mosaic (i.e., none of the above) to each plot based
#' on the percent of live basal area of canopy trees in pole, mature and large size classes. Plots must be
#' closed-canopy forest to be classified for this metric. Therefore plots classified as Woodlands (ACAD only)
#' or Early successional (SARA only) in the field are automatically assigned those classes in the calculation.
#' Must run importData first.

  canopy_trees <- c(2, 3, 4)

  # Set up tree data
  tree_stand_str <- tree_live %>% filter(CrownClassCode %in% canopy_trees) %>%
                                  mutate(pole_size = ifelse(ParkUnit == 'ACAD', 20, 26),
                                         mature_size = ifelse(ParkUnit == 'ACAD', 34.9, 45.9),
                                         BA_pole = ifelse(DBHcm < pole_size, BA_cm2, 0),
                                         BA_mature = ifelse(DBHcm >= pole_size & DBHcm < mature_size, BA_cm2, 0),
                                         BA_large = ifelse(DBHcm > mature_size, BA_cm2, 0))

  # Summarize to plot-level
  stand_str <- tree_stand_str %>% group_by(EventID, Plot_Name) %>%
                                  summarize(BA_tot = sum(BA_cm2),
                                            pctBA_pole = sum(BA_pole) / BA_tot * 100,
                                            pctBA_mature = sum(BA_mature) / BA_tot * 100,
                                            pctBA_large = sum(BA_large) / BA_tot * 100,
                                            .groups = 'drop')

  # Add in stand structure, so woodlands and early successional are not part of stage calculation
  stand_str2 <- full_join(stand_str, stand_df %>% select(EventID, Plot_Name, Stand_Structure),
                          by = c("EventID", "Plot_Name"))

  stand_str3 <- stand_str2 %>%
                      mutate(Stage = case_when(Stand_Structure == 'Woodland (ACAD only)' ~ 'Woodland',
                             Stand_Structure == 'Early successional' ~ 'Early_successional',
                             pctBA_pole + pctBA_mature >= 67 & pctBA_pole > pctBA_mature ~ 'Pole',
                             pctBA_pole + pctBA_mature >= 67 & pctBA_pole <= pctBA_mature | pctBA_mature >= 67 ~ 'Mature',
                             pctBA_mature + pctBA_large >= 67 & pctBA_large > pctBA_mature ~ 'Late_successional',
                             TRUE ~ 'Mosaic')
    )
